Summary

Dr. Steven Doerstling is an internal medicine physician who graduated from Duke University School of Medicine. With four years of experience in practice, he focuses on caring for adult patients with a wide range of medical conditions. His training from Duke provides him with a strong foundation in comprehensive internal medicine care.

Dr. Doerstling practices at Stanford Hospital in Stanford, California. He has experience treating serious infections like sepsis and skin infections such as cellulitis. His clinical skills include performing heart rhythm tests and abdominal imaging studies to help diagnose various medical conditions.
